• JoomlaWorks Simple Image Rotator
  • JoomlaWorks Simple Image Rotator
  • JoomlaWorks Simple Image Rotator
  • JoomlaWorks Simple Image Rotator
  • JoomlaWorks Simple Image Rotator
  • JoomlaWorks Simple Image Rotator
  • JoomlaWorks Simple Image Rotator
  • JoomlaWorks Simple Image Rotator
  • JoomlaWorks Simple Image Rotator
  • JoomlaWorks Simple Image Rotator
 
  Bookmark and Share
 
 
Disertación de Maestría
DOI
https://doi.org/10.11606/D.45.2020.tde-27022020-150840
Documento
Autor
Nombre completo
Bruno Padilha
Dirección Electrónica
Instituto/Escuela/Facultad
Área de Conocimiento
Fecha de Defensa
Publicación
São Paulo, 2018
Director
Tribunal
Ferreira, João Eduardo (Presidente)
Digiampietri, Luciano Antonio
Roberto, Rafael Liberato
Título en portugués
WED-SQL: uma linguagem declarativa intermediária com apoio transacional para a modelagem e implementação de Sistemas de Informação Cientes de Processos.
Palabras clave en portugués
Processos de negócio
Sistemas de Informação Cientes de Processos
Transações de longa duração
WED-flow
WED-SQL
Workflow
Resumen en portugués
Os Sistemas de Informação Cientes de Processo (PAIS), os quais incluem os Sistemas de Gerenciamento de Processo de Negócio (BPM) e os Sistemas Gerenciadores de Workflows, tem evoluído continuamente para atender às demandas por sistemas cada vez mais complexos tanto no domínio de processos de negócio quanto no campo dos processos científicos. Não obstante, as abordagens tradicionais ainda são incapazes de prover uma integração simples e direta entre a modelagem e a implementação de tais sistemas. As abordagens formais (e.g. Álgebras de Processos e Redes de Petri) são suficientes para a especificação de sistemas que possam ser formalmente verificados, no entanto sua implementação é difícil e não padronizada. A notação BPMN, largamente empregada como ferramenta de modelagem de processos de negócio, apesar de simples e funcional, não aborda de forma criteriosa aspectos importantes de implementação. Por outro lado, WS-BPEL é uma linguagem desenvolvida apenas para controle de execução de processos de negócio, negligenciando a modelagem. Além do mais, nenhuma dessas abordagens é suficientemente adequada para tratar estratégias adaptativas, as quais implicam em mudanças estruturais recorrentes no sistema de software. Nesse contexto, com base na abordagem WED-flow, este trabalho apresenta a WED-SQL: uma linguagem intermediária declarativa, específica de domínio (DSL), e com apoio transacional para a modelagem e implementação de PAIS.
Título en inglés
WED-SQL: an intermediate transactional based declarative language for modeling and implementation of Process-Aware Information Systems
Palabras clave en inglés
Business Process Management
Long lived transactions
PAIS
WED-flow
WED-SQL
Workflow
Resumen en inglés
Process-Aware Information Systems (PAIS), which include Business Process Management (BPM) systems and Workflow Management systems, have been evolving to fulfill the requirements of increasingly complex business and scientific applications. In spite of all efforts, traditional approaches still struggle to provide a seamless integration between the structural design and implementation of such systems. Formal approaches (e.g. Process Algebras and Petri Net) are sufficient to specify systems that can be formally verifiable, albeit unwieldy to implement. The widespread BPMN notation is remarkably effective and a easy to use tool for modeling despite setting aside implementation aspects. On the other hand, the WS-BPEL is a language for execution control of business process that lacks support for modeling. Furthermore, none of these approaches are ideal to handle adaptive strategies that result in recurrent application structural changes. In this context, based on the WED-flow approach, we present WED-SQL: a transactional based, domain-specific, intermediate declarative language for modeling and implementation of PAIS.
 
ADVERTENCIA - La consulta de este documento queda condicionada a la aceptación de las siguientes condiciones de uso:
Este documento es únicamente para usos privados enmarcados en actividades de investigación y docencia. No se autoriza su reproducción con finalidades de lucro. Esta reserva de derechos afecta tanto los datos del documento como a sus contenidos. En la utilización o cita de partes del documento es obligado indicar el nombre de la persona autora.
padilha_master.pdf (2.20 Mbytes)
Fecha de Publicación
2020-03-20
 
ADVERTENCIA: Aprenda que son los trabajos derivados haciendo clic aquí.
Todos los derechos de la tesis/disertación pertenecen a los autores
CeTI-SC/STI
Biblioteca Digital de Tesis y Disertaciones de la USP. Copyright © 2001-2024. Todos los derechos reservados.